Showy Goldenrod Perennial American Native Wildflower Butterflies Bees Solidago Goldenrod is one of the best wildflowers for late fall blooming and is very showy with large heads and flower clusters. Butterflies, hummingbirds, goldfinches, and other small birds are attracted to Solidago and feed on its nectar and flower seeds. This Goldenrod wildflower is very versatile, native to the United States, and has many uses such as roadside plantings, providing wildlife with food and habitat, naturalized settings, and wildflower gardens. Flower SpecificationsSeason: PerennialUSDA Zones: 3 - 9Height: 24 - 36 inchesBloom Season: Late summer and fallBloom Color: GoldenEnvironment: Full sunSoil Type: Sand, loam, well-drained, pH 6.2 - 7.4Foliage Color: Light greenDeer Resistant: YesLatin Name: Solidago RigidaPlanting DirectionsTemperature: 68FAverage Germ Time: 10 - 14 daysLight Required: YesDepth: Surface sow down to 1/8 inchSowing Rate: 5000 seeds covers 200 square feetMoisture: Keep seeds moist
